Common Gynaecological Problems
Female wellness problems can range from less severe and temporary problems to severe and long-term conditions. Below is a list of most frequently reported issues:
1. **Menstrual Irregularities**
Irregular periods, such as heavy bleeding, missed periods, or unusually long cycles, are widely reported caused by endocrine disturbances, anxiety, or underlying diseases like pol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S). Females must keep track of shifts in their monthly periods and seek care if symptoms worsen.
2. **Polycystic Ovary Syndrome (PCOS)**
PCOS is a hormonal disorder that causes abnormal ovarian growths to grow on the female reproductive glands. The disorder often causes disrupted menstrual cycles, reproductive challenges, excessive hair growth, and obesity. Many infertility cases stem from conception difficulties.
